Allergy sufferers can benefit from the anti-inflammatory properties of ginger to control their symptoms. According to studies, people with hay fever who consumed ginger experienced less sneezing and a reduced production of mucus in the nose.
To get some relief, take a piece of ginger root, peel and cut it, and then pour boiling hot water over it. Leave it for about 10 minutes and drink. You may want to use honey as a sweetener if you wish. This has a straightaway impact on the body’s anti-inflammatory processes.
